I'm on following medicines since 16 days for RA:
1. Baclofen 10mg OD
2. Deflazacort 6mg OD
3. Gabapentin+Methylcobalamin HS
4. Multivitamin
I have been feeling very low, extremely weak, sad and sleepy since 2 days.
Is this side effect & will subside on its own or anything else?

The medications you are taking for RA are known to cause some side effects, such as dizziness, drowsiness, fatigue, and depression. Baclofen and gabapentin can both cause sedation, and deflazacort is a steroid that can affect mood and energy levels. It is possible that your current symptoms are related to the medications you are taking.
I would recommend contacting your doctor to discuss these symptoms further. They may want to adjust your medication dosages or switch you to different medications to address these side effects. Additionally, it is important to make sure that your symptoms are not related to any other underlying medical conditions.
In the meantime, try to get enough rest and stay hydrated. Avoid driving or operating heavy machinery if you feel excessively drowsy or sedated. If you experience any other concerning symptoms, seek medical attention right away.
